Save the Dates
Dates for 2026 are from Thursday, 18th June to Sunday, 21st June 2026, once again returning to the beautiful Seaclose Park in Newport to create an electrifying haven of music. Over four days of pure adrenaline, a lineup featuring legendary headliners, emerging stars, and family-friendly fun will be present.
Looking at 2026
TThe Cure perform their first UK show of the year, celebrating their delayed return surrounding the release of the well-received album Songs of a Lost World, while after a two-year break, Lewis Capaldi is back on tour, and Calvin Harris is ready to transform Saturday night into a full-on party, with his string of global hits.
